This commit is contained in:
Ahmed Bouhuolia
2025-11-19 22:59:21 +02:00
parent 17bcc14231
commit 2b384b2f6f
31 changed files with 405 additions and 62 deletions

View File

@@ -25,7 +25,7 @@ export class ManualJournalsApplication {
private getManualJournalsService: GetManualJournals,
private bulkDeleteManualJournalsService: BulkDeleteManualJournalsService,
private validateBulkDeleteManualJournalsService: ValidateBulkDeleteManualJournalsService,
) {}
) { }
/**
* Make journal entries.
@@ -65,9 +65,13 @@ export class ManualJournalsApplication {
* Bulk deletes manual journals.
* @param {number[]} manualJournalIds
*/
public bulkDeleteManualJournals = (manualJournalIds: number[]) => {
public bulkDeleteManualJournals = (
manualJournalIds: number[],
options?: { skipUndeletable?: boolean },
) => {
return this.bulkDeleteManualJournalsService.bulkDeleteManualJournals(
manualJournalIds,
options,
);
};